Join Mark for this professional three-day course to learn everything from making a chocolate wedding cake all the way through to decorating it.
Course tutor: Mark Tilling
You will learn new and contemporary techniques with Mark who will show you how to make chocolate sponge cakes, chocolate fillings, how to use syrup alcohol flavouring and even the science behind working with chocolate.
Mark will teach you about storing chocolate, shelf life and planning guidelines for making professional chocolate cakes. This is an essential course to attend whether you are making cakes for a business, or for friends and family.
But it’s not all work – you will also have the opportunity to make taste comparisons of cake fillings, ganache and various grades of chocolate.
The techniques covered include:
- Colouring chocolate and cocoa butter
- Making chocolate pencils
- Making smooth and rustic decorations
- Working on marble to make fans and wraps
- Making chocolate roses
tempering, piping, transfer sheets, moulds, flower decorations, cups, colouring, wraps and fans, airbrushing, making ganache.
